ポルカドット(DOT)プロジェクトの透明性に迫る



ポルカドット(DOT)プロジェクトの透明性に迫る


ポルカドット(DOT)プロジェクトの透明性に迫る

ポルカドット(Polkadot)は、異なるブロックチェーン間の相互運用性を実現することを目的とした、次世代の分散型ウェブ(Web3)基盤として注目を集めています。その革新的なアーキテクチャとガバナンスモデルは、ブロックチェーン技術の進化に大きな影響を与えると期待されています。本稿では、ポルカドットプロジェクトの透明性に着目し、その仕組み、構成要素、そして透明性を担保するための取り組みについて詳細に解説します。

1. ポルカドットの概要とアーキテクチャ

ポルカドットは、単一のブロックチェーンではなく、複数の独立したブロックチェーン(パラチェーン)が連携して動作するネットワークです。このパラチェーンは、ポルカドットの中核となるリレーチェーンに接続され、相互運用性を実現します。リレーチェーンは、ネットワーク全体のセキュリティとコンセンサスを担保する役割を担います。

ポルカドットのアーキテクチャは、以下の主要な要素で構成されています。

  • リレーチェーン(Relay Chain): ポルカドットの中核となるブロックチェーンであり、ネットワーク全体のセキュリティ、コンセンサス、相互運用性を管理します。
  • パラチェーン(Parachain): 独立したブロックチェーンであり、特定のアプリケーションやユースケースに特化して動作します。リレーチェーンに接続することで、相互運用性を実現します。
  • ブリッジ(Bridge): ポルカドットネットワークと外部のブロックチェーン(例えば、ビットコインやイーサリアム)との間で、トークンやデータを転送するための仕組みです。
  • パラチェーンスロットオークション(Parachain Slot Auction): パラチェーンがリレーチェーンに接続するためのスロットを獲得するためのオークションです。DOTトークンを使用して参加します。

2. 透明性の重要性とポルカドットにおける課題

ブロックチェーン技術の信頼性を高める上で、透明性は不可欠な要素です。透明性が高いほど、ネットワークの動作状況や取引履歴を検証しやすくなり、不正行為や改ざんのリスクを低減することができます。ポルカドットにおいても、透明性はプロジェクトの成功に重要な役割を果たします。

しかし、ポルカドットの複雑なアーキテクチャは、透明性を担保する上でいくつかの課題を抱えています。例えば、パラチェーンはそれぞれ独立して動作するため、その内部の動作状況をリレーチェーンから直接監視することは困難です。また、パラチェーンスロットオークションのプロセスや、ガバナンスにおける意思決定プロセスも、透明性の観点から改善の余地があります。

3. ポルカドットの透明性を担保する仕組み

ポルカドットプロジェクトは、透明性を高めるために、様々な仕組みを導入しています。

3.1. オンチェーンガバナンス

ポルカドットは、オンチェーンガバナンスを採用しており、DOTトークン保有者は、ネットワークのアップグレードやパラメータ変更などの重要な意思決定に直接参加することができます。提案は、DOTトークン保有者による投票によって承認されるため、透明性が高く、民主的なプロセスと言えます。ガバナンスに関する情報は、ポルカドットの公式ウェブサイトやブロックエクスプローラーで公開されており、誰でも確認することができます。

3.2. Substrateフレームワーク

ポルカドットの基盤となるSubstrateフレームワークは、ブロックチェーンの開発を容易にするためのツールとライブラリを提供します。Substrateを使用することで、開発者は、透明性の高いブロックチェーンを容易に構築することができます。Substrateは、モジュール式の設計を採用しており、必要な機能を柔軟に追加・変更することができます。また、Substrateは、Rustプログラミング言語を使用しており、セキュリティとパフォーマンスに優れています。

3.3. パラチェーンの可視化ツール

ポルカドットのエコシステムでは、パラチェーンの動作状況を可視化するためのツールが開発されています。これらのツールを使用することで、ユーザーは、パラチェーンのトランザクション数、ブロック生成時間、ネットワークの状態などをリアルタイムで確認することができます。これにより、パラチェーンの透明性が向上し、ユーザーは、より安心してパラチェーンを利用することができます。

3.4. オープンソースコード

ポルカドットプロジェクトのコードは、すべてオープンソースとして公開されています。これにより、誰でもコードを検証し、改善提案を行うことができます。オープンソースであることは、透明性を高める上で非常に重要な要素です。また、オープンソースであることで、コミュニティによる開発が促進され、プロジェクトの進化を加速することができます。

3.5. ブロックエクスプローラー

ポルカドットのブロックチェーンの取引履歴やブロック情報を確認できるブロックエクスプローラーが提供されています。これにより、ユーザーは、ネットワークの動作状況を透明に把握することができます。ブロックエクスプローラーは、ポルカドットの公式ウェブサイトからアクセスすることができます。

4. 透明性向上のための今後の展望

ポルカドットプロジェクトは、透明性をさらに向上させるために、以下の取り組みを推進していくと考えられます。

  • パラチェーン間の相互運用性の強化: パラチェーン間の相互運用性を強化することで、より多くの情報が共有され、透明性が向上します。
  • ガバナンスプロセスの改善: ガバナンスプロセスをより効率的かつ透明性の高いものにすることで、コミュニティの参加を促進し、より良い意思決定を行うことができます。
  • 可視化ツールの拡充: パラチェーンの動作状況をより詳細に可視化するためのツールを拡充することで、ユーザーの理解を深め、透明性を向上させます。
  • セキュリティ監査の強化: 定期的なセキュリティ監査を実施することで、潜在的な脆弱性を早期に発見し、修正することができます。

5. ポルカドットの透明性と他のブロックチェーンとの比較

ポルカドットの透明性は、他のブロックチェーンと比較して、いくつかの点で優れています。例えば、オンチェーンガバナンスを採用している点は、多くのブロックチェーンがオフチェーンガバナンスを採用しているのとは対照的です。また、Substrateフレームワークを使用することで、開発者は、透明性の高いブロックチェーンを容易に構築することができます。しかし、ポルカドットの複雑なアーキテクチャは、透明性を担保する上で課題も抱えています。例えば、パラチェーンの内部の動作状況をリレーチェーンから直接監視することは困難です。

ビットコインは、そのシンプルな設計と公開された取引履歴により、高い透明性を誇ります。しかし、ビットコインのガバナンスは、開発者コミュニティによって主導されるため、透明性に欠けるという批判もあります。イーサリアムは、スマートコントラクトの公開により、高い透明性を実現しています。しかし、イーサリアムのガバナンスも、開発者コミュニティによって主導されるため、透明性に欠けるという批判もあります。

まとめ

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的とした、革新的なプロジェクトです。その透明性は、オンチェーンガバナンス、Substrateフレームワーク、パラチェーンの可視化ツール、オープンソースコード、ブロックエクスプローラーなどの仕組みによって担保されています。しかし、ポルカドットの複雑なアーキテクチャは、透明性を担保する上で課題も抱えています。今後、ポルカドットプロジェクトは、透明性をさらに向上させるために、パラチェーン間の相互運用性の強化、ガバナンスプロセスの改善、可視化ツールの拡充、セキュリティ監査の強化などの取り組みを推進していくと考えられます。ポルカドットの透明性の向上は、ブロックチェーン技術の信頼性を高め、Web3の普及を促進する上で重要な役割を果たすでしょう。


前の記事

ネム(XEM)の価格チャートから読み取るトレンド

次の記事

暗号資産(仮想通貨)詐欺被害を防ぐ実践的テクニック